With years under my belt in IT tech, I'm here to guide you through an in-depth review of Datadog software. I'll lay out the facts, features, and facets of this tool, helping you gauge if it aligns with your needs. Your decision to choose the right software matters and I'm committed to providing clarity on Datadog's capabilities. Let's explore together.
Datadog Software Product Overview
Datadog is an observability and monitoring tool designed to aggregate metrics, logs, and traces from diverse sources. It primarily targets DevOps teams, software engineers, and other technology professionals, ensuring real-time visibility into their infrastructure and applications. The tool shines by alleviating the challenges of troubleshooting, identifying bottlenecks, and ensuring robust application performance monitoring. Its standout features include custom dashboards, log management, and seamless integrations with cloud providers like AWS and Azure.
- Custom Dashboards: Datadog allows users to design custom metrics and visualization graphs, enhancing the user experience by providing relevant insights tailored to specific use cases.
- Integration Prowess: With its ability to connect with major platforms like AWS, Azure, and Kubernetes, Datadog positions itself as a go-to monitoring solution for diverse tech stacks.
- Advanced APM: Datadog's application performance monitoring functionality provides precise insights into backend processes, making troubleshooting and identifying root causes more intuitive.
- Learning Curve: New end users might find Datadog's plethora of features slightly overwhelming, requiring a period of familiarization.
- Retention Limits: While Datadog offers a plethora of metrics and log management tools, some users might find retention periods limiting, especially when comparing historical data.
- Notifications Threshold: Some users have noted that setting up optimal thresholds for notifications can be tricky, sometimes resulting in alert fatigue.
In my experience, Datadog excels in providing comprehensive monitoring solutions, especially with its APM and cloud-based integrations. However, when judging its total package, there's a slight learning curve that might deter some newcomers. It's especially well-suited for organizations deeply entrenched in AWS, Azure, or Kubernetes ecosystems, as it seamlessly captures and visualizes data from these platforms.
Datadog: The Bottom Line
What truly distinguishes Datadog from other monitoring software is its unparalleled ability to provide observability across a diverse range of platforms, especially major cloud providers. The tool’s custom dashboard functionality and real-time data visualization make it a compelling choice for those looking to dive deep into their tech stack’s performance. It's not just a monitoring solution; it's a powerful ally for any DevOps team or software engineer aiming for peak system health.
Datadog Deep Dive
Here's a deep dive into Datadog’s features, best use cases, pricing, customer support, and other purchase factors.
- User-Friendly Interface - Yes
- Cloud-Based Deployment - Yes
- Customizable Dashboards - Yes
- Real-time Monitoring - Yes
- Log Management - Yes
- Alerts and Notifications - Yes
- Integration Capabilities - Yes
- API Access - Yes
- Mobile App - Yes
- Security and Encryption - Yes
- Role-Based Access Control (RBAC) - Yes
- Backup and Data Recovery - Yes
- Troubleshooting Tools - Yes
- Scalability - Yes
- Application Performance Monitoring (APM) - Yes
- Network Monitoring - Yes
- User Activity Tracking - Yes
- Custom Reporting - Yes
- SLA Management - No
- On-Premises Deployment - Yes
- Multilingual Support - No
- Automated Workflows - Yes
- Customer Support & Knowledge Base - Yes
- License Management - No
- Open Source Availability - No
- Real-time Monitoring: Datadog offers immediate visibility into your entire technology stack, making it indispensable for startups to large enterprises wanting instant insights.
- Customizable Dashboards: The SaaS platform allows users to tailor dashboards specifically for their needs, presenting a comprehensive view of their infrastructure and applications in one place.
- Cloud Monitoring: With robust integration capabilities with Amazon Web Services and other cloud providers, Datadog ensures comprehensive cloud monitoring, reducing potential downtime and enhancing system health.
- Full-stack Observability: Datadog's full-stack monitoring offers a bird's-eye view of your entire tech stack, from infrastructure to application layers, ensuring no detail is overlooked.
- Network Monitoring: By providing an intricate network monitoring solution, Datadog ensures that every component of your technology network, from servers to connected devices, operates optimally.
- Datadog Agent: This unique agent facilitates seamless instrumentation, collecting metrics, and data across your system, giving Datadog its renowned depth in insights.
- Synthetic Monitoring: Datadog’s synthetic monitoring tests applications in a controlled environment, simulating real user behaviors and identifying potential issues before they reach end-users.
- Mobile App: The Datadog mobile app ensures IT teams stay informed on-the-go, providing crucial metrics and alerts directly to their smartphones.
- Integration with Slack: By integrating seamlessly with communication tools like Slack, Datadog fosters rapid response to issues, keeping teams aligned and informed.
- Datadog Support: With verified and expert-level support, Datadog users can swiftly navigate challenges, ensuring they make the most of this great product for their specific needs.
- Full-stack Observability: While many IT software solutions offer infrastructure monitoring or application performance insights, Datadog seamlessly blends the two with its full-stack observability, ensuring users get a comprehensive view from the server level right up to the user interface.
- Real User Monitoring (RUM): Datadog's RUM offers a deeper dive into the end-user experience by collecting data from actual user sessions, which helps businesses understand user behaviors, interactions, and potential bottlenecks in real-world scenarios, a feature not commonly found in standard IT monitoring tools.
- Seamless Microsoft Integrations: Datadog's adaptability with Microsoft products and ecosystems goes beyond generic integrations, offering in-depth insights and metrics specific to Microsoft technologies, enabling teams to optimize their deployments and operations efficiently.
Datadog provides native integrations with a vast array of tools, including but not limited to Amazon Web Services, Azure, and various databases, ensuring seamless observability across multiple platforms. They offer an API, allowing businesses to customize, extend, and integrate Datadog capabilities with other systems or develop proprietary applications. Additionally, the Datadog Marketplace offers various add-ons, enabling users to extend the platform's functionality based on specific needs and industry requirements.
- Free Tier: Datadog offers a free plan with limited features, which is ideal for small teams or individuals looking to explore the tool without committing financially.
- Pro Plan: Priced at $15/user/month (billed annually), the Pro Plan offers enhanced observability features, including detailed infrastructure monitoring and alerting.
- Enterprise Plan: At $23/user/month (billed annually) + $49 base fee per month, this plan is designed for larger organizations or those needing advanced features and integrations. It includes all the Pro features plus premium support and advanced security measures.
- Custom Plan: Pricing upon request. For organizations with specialized needs, Datadog offers a custom pricing option, allowing for tailored solutions and pricing structures.
Ease of Use
Navigating Datadog's interface presents a moderate learning curve, especially for those unfamiliar with comprehensive monitoring tools. While its array of features offers deep insights, it can initially overwhelm users due to the sheer volume of information and customization options. The onboarding process aids in easing this transition, but a new user will likely need some time to become fully acquainted with all its functionalities and organization.
Datadog offers a robust range of support channels, including documentation, webinars, and live chat, which generally meet users' needs. While the resources provided are comprehensive, some users express frustrations over varying response times, especially during peak periods. Additionally, though the majority find answers in their documentation, a few users highlight moments when navigating it becomes less intuitive.
Datadog Use Case
Who would be a good fit for Datadog?
Datadog shines brightest in environments demanding comprehensive observability, making it a favorite among tech-driven enterprises, startups, and DevOps teams. Companies that manage complex technology stacks, especially those leveraging cloud services like AWS or Azure, find the tool's depth and customization pivotal to their monitoring needs.
Who would be a good fit for Datadog?
Smaller businesses or teams with simple infrastructure might find Datadog overwhelming and more intricate than necessary for their needs. Additionally, industries not heavily reliant on technology might see little value in the tool's expansive features and may struggle to justify its cost.
What is Datadog primarily used for?
Datadog is primarily used for infrastructure monitoring, application performance monitoring (APM), and logging, providing insights into system health and performance.
Can Datadog integrate with cloud platforms?
Yes, Datadog offers native integrations with leading cloud platforms like Amazon Web Services (AWS), Microsoft Azure, and more.
Does Datadog support real user monitoring (RUM)?
Yes, Datadog provides real user monitoring (RUM) to capture user interactions and performance metrics from actual user sessions.
Is there a mobile app for Datadog?
Yes, Datadog offers a mobile app that provides access to key metrics, dashboards, and alerts on the go.
Can I customize the dashboards in Datadog?
Absolutely, Datadog allows for full customization of dashboards, tailoring them to your specific monitoring needs.
How does Datadog handle security and data privacy?
Datadog takes security seriously with features like role-based access controls, SSO, and data encryption both in transit and at rest.
Is there a free version of Datadog available?
Yes, Datadog does offer a free tier with limited features, ideal for small teams or individuals wanting to explore the tool.
Can Datadog alert me in case of infrastructure issues or anomalies?
Definitely, Datadog provides alerting capabilities based on user-defined thresholds or automated anomaly detection, ensuring you stay informed about potential issues.
Alternatives to Datadog
- New Relic: Often chosen for its exceptional application performance monitoring, New Relic provides detailed insights into app behavior, making it especially valuable for software engineers focused on optimizing user experience. Learn its features in my New Relic review.
- Dynatrace: Dynatrace stands out with its AI-powered auto-detection and root cause analysis, ensuring faster troubleshooting and resolution of issues, ideal for environments where rapid response to system anomalies is essential. Know more about the software in this Dynatrace review.
- Splunk: Renowned for its powerful log management and analytics, Splunk is a top choice for organizations that need deep insights into their logs for security, compliance, or detailed system performance analysis.
Datadog Company Overview & History
Datadog is a SaaS-based monitoring and analytics platform that assists companies in optimizing the performance of their applications and infrastructure. Many tech-driven enterprises and startups leverage its comprehensive toolset.
Headquartered in New York City, Datadog is a public company listed on the NASDAQ, with Olivier Pomel and Alexis Lê-Quôc as its co-founders. Since its inception in 2010, it has reached significant milestones, including its IPO in 2019, and has been guided by its mission to "break down silos between developers, operations, and business users" and ensure technological performance and scale.
Datadog emerges as a comprehensive monitoring and analytics solution, tailored especially for businesses with complex tech stacks. Its deep integrations, rich feature set, and adaptability make it an attractive choice for both startups and established enterprises. However, like any tool, its efficacy will largely depend on your specific use case and infrastructure.
If you've had experience with Datadog or are considering it, I'd love to hear from you. Your insights and experiences can greatly benefit others in the community. Please share your thoughts in the comments below!